Role Overview
As our Flight Operations Program Manager, you’ll own the cross-functional programs that keep our growing fleet delivering on that promise — driving aircraft delivery, onboarding, and operational readiness, and giving the whole organization a clear, real-time picture of where things stand. You’ll work directly with Flight Operations, Technology, and our partners, and you’ll brief the executive team.
What You’ll Do
- Own end-to-end program plans for flight operations initiatives — scope, milestones, risks, and KPIs — and drive them to completion across multiple teams.
- Drive aircraft delivery and onboarding readiness, tracking every task from acquisition through operational readiness.
- Build the dashboards and trackers that give BOND a single source of truth on fleet delivery, onboarding, maintenance, and program health.
- Partner with Flight Operations, Technology, and external partners to keep programs grounded in operational reality.
- Manage vendor and partner relationships, holding them accountable to scope and timeline.
- Translate operational data into executive-ready reporting and present it directly to our leadership team.
- Identify process gaps and lead the improvements that make us faster, more reliable, and more scalable.
Required Qualifications
- 6+ years of program or project management experience owning cross-functional programs with measurable outcomes.
- Bachelor’s degree, or equivalent practical experience.
- Strong technology fluency — comfortable across modern SaaS and operational tools (project/work-management platforms, CRM such as Salesforce, BI/dashboards) and quick to learn new systems.
- A track record of presenting to and influencing senior and executive stakeholders.
- Proven ability to juggle competing priorities and deliver in a fast-moving environment.
- Excellent written and verbal communication, translating complex operational detail into clear decisions.
- Fluency in AI tools like Claude, with the ability to apply them to everyday program and operational work.
Preferred Qualifications
- Experience in aviation, aerospace, or another regulated, operationally complex industry (Part 91/135, charter, fractional, FBO, or OEM).
- Familiarity with task and project management tools like Jira or monday.com.
- Hands-on experience building dashboards, reports, or lightweight tooling (SQL, BI tools, or AI/automation platforms a plus).
- A degree in aviation management or aeronautical science, or PMP/PgMP certification.
